Average First-Line Supervisors of Construction Trades and Extraction Workers Salary in Manchester-Nashua, NH

First-Line Supervisors of Construction Trades and Extraction Workers in the Manchester-Nashua, NH area earn an impressive average annual salary of $91,390. This figure notably surpasses the national average of $84,960, suggesting that local market dynamics and demand contribute to a higher compensation for these essential roles. The specific economic landscape of Manchester-Nashua likely influences this elevated pay scale.

First-Line Supervisors of Construction Trades and Extraction Workers Salary Distribution in Manchester-Nashua, NH

Salary progression for First-Line Supervisors of Construction Trades and Extraction Workers is significantly influenced by experience. Entry-level positions typically command lower salaries, while seasoned professionals with extensive experience in managing complex projects and teams can expect to earn considerably more. The widening gap between entry-level and senior-level salaries, often reflected in salary percentile distributions, clearly signifies substantial career advancement opportunities and earning potential within this field.

Experience LevelMarket PercentileAnnual WageHourly Rate
ApprenticeLearning trade under supervision. Classroom + OJT.10% (Entry)$59,300$28.5
JourneymanLicensed/Certified. Works independently on standard tasks.25% (Junior)$68,543$33
Senior TechnicianHandles complex installations & troubleshooting.50% (Median)$84,880$40.8
Foreman / MasterSupervises crews, handles permits & code compliance.75% (Senior)$114,238$54.9
SuperintendentSite management, business owner, or master tradesman.90% (Expert)$130,000$62.5
